SUSE10环境下Oracle11g安装配置与自动启动
版权申诉
76 浏览量
更新于2024-06-29
收藏 2.91MB PDF 举报
"该资源为SUSE10操作系统下安装Oracle11g的详细步骤,包括前提条件、软件包检查、用户组与用户创建、Oracle的安装配置,并提及了PlSQL和SSH的相关设置,适用于系统管理员和DBA进行参考。"
在SUSE10上安装Oracle11g是一个涉及多步骤的过程,需要满足一定的系统要求和配置环境。以下是对安装过程的详细解释:
1. **安装前提**:
- 首先,确保你以root用户身份登录。
- Oracle11g的安装需要至少1GB的物理内存,可以通过`grep MemTotal /proc/meminfo`命令查看内存大小。
- 检查swap交换分区的状态,使用`grep SwapTotal /proc/meminfo`命令。
- 确保`/tmp`目录有足够的空闲空间,可以使用`df -h /tmp`查看。
- 安装XManger2软件,这可能是用于图形化管理Oracle的工具。
2. **检查软件包需求**:
- 验证系统中是否已安装一系列必要的软件包,如binutils、compat-libstdc++、glibc、glibc-devel、gcc、ksh、libaio、libaio-devel、libelf、libgcc、libstdc++、libstdc++-devel、make、sysstat、unixODBC和unixODBC-devel。如果缺少,可以通过RPM命令安装或从网上下载runora包进行安装。
3. **创建用户组和用户**:
- Oracle推荐使用特定的用户组(oinstall、dba)和用户(oracle)进行安装和管理。SUSE10可能已经预创建了这些,如果存在,需要先删除再重新创建。使用`groupdel`和`userdel -r`命令进行操作。
4. **安装Oracle11g**:
- 将Oracle的ISO文件上传到root目录下。
- 按照Oracle的安装指南进行操作,通常包括选择安装类型、指定安装路径、配置数据库参数等。
- 创建所需的目录结构,例如ORACLE_HOME,以及数据文件、日志文件和控制文件的存放位置。
- 设置环境变量,如ORACLE_HOME、ORACLE_SID、PATH等。
- 安装完成后,配置Oracle服务以实现自动启动。
5. **配置Oracle自动启动**:
- 使用systemd或传统的init脚本来配置Oracle数据库服务在系统启动时自动启动。
- 更新启动脚本,确保所有必要的环境变量和启动参数正确。
6. **安装配置PL/SQL Developer**:
- PL/SQL Developer是一种用于Oracle数据库的集成开发环境,可能需要安装相应的客户端组件,如Instant Client,以连接到Oracle服务器。
- 配置连接参数,如主机名、端口、服务名等。
7. **配置SSH**:
- 安装SSH服务,允许远程通过SSH连接到服务器进行数据库管理。
- 配置SSH公钥认证以实现无密码登录,提高安全性。
8. **安全与维护**:
- 遵循Oracle的最佳实践,对数据库进行安全配置,如限制不必要的网络访问、加密敏感数据、定期备份等。
- 定期监控系统性能,使用sysstat等工具收集性能指标。
整个过程需要细致且遵循最佳实践,确保系统的稳定性和安全性。安装完成后,你可以通过PlSQL Developer或其他管理工具进行数据库管理和开发工作,同时通过SSH进行远程管理。
点击了解资源详情
2012-03-16 上传
2012-09-06 上传
2018-06-05 上传
2011-10-28 上传
春哥111
- 粉丝: 1w+
- 资源: 5万+
最新资源
- Aspose资源包:转PDF无水印学习工具
- Go语言控制台输入输出操作教程
- 红外遥控报警器原理及应用详解下载
- 控制卷筒纸侧面位置的先进装置技术解析
- 易语言加解密例程源码详解与实践
- SpringMVC客户管理系统:Hibernate与Bootstrap集成实践
- 深入理解JavaScript Set与WeakSet的使用
- 深入解析接收存储及发送装置的广播技术方法
- zyString模块1.0源码公开-易语言编程利器
- Android记分板UI设计:SimpleScoreboard的简洁与高效
- 量子网格列设置存储组件:开源解决方案
- 全面技术源码合集:CcVita Php Check v1.1
- 中军创易语言抢购软件:付款功能解析
- Python手动实现图像滤波教程
- MATLAB源代码实现基于DFT的量子传输分析
- 开源程序Hukoch.exe:简化食谱管理与导入功能